Transaction 3995c84597bddb0a3f4ad2e7368a0d85d7c48ef6e7c5eae544904d3f7b546b44
1 Input
1 Output
-
3995c84597bddb0a3f4ad2e7368a0d85d7c48ef6e7c5eae544904d3f7b546b44:0
- value
- 1295822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bec44bd6e1eea7bf4d001e63e7903d3bedd9fbb OP_EQUAL
- address
- 35hG21vUXJi1M6gPWUtnF1Ht7j1fvmnUuN